Most Diverse Public Schools in Idaho

The average public school diversity score in Idaho is approximately 0.42 per year (2023-24).
The most diverse public schools are listed below (where sufficient data available).
The most diverse school in Idaho is currently Lakeside Elementary School, with a diversity score of 0.72.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the Idaho average public schools diversity score?
The Idaho average public schools diversity score is 0.42 for 2023-24.
